#PNAME# flag description

The Utah state flag features a deep navy blue field with the state seal displayed prominently in the center. The seal showcases a bald eagle, symbolizing protection, clutching a shield with the iconic beehive in the center. The beehive represents industry and perseverance, while the cross on top symbolizes the state's faith and dedication to God. Above the shield is a banner that reads "Industry" and below it reads "Utah," showcasing the state's commitment to hard work and progress. The background is adorned with the date "1847," commemorating the year that the Mormon pioneers arrived in the Salt Lake Valley. Overall, the flag is a beautiful and symbolic representation of Utah's values and history.

Frequently Ask Questions About the Flag of Utah

What is the significance of the beehive on the Utah state flag?

The beehive on the Utah state flag symbolizes industry and the state's nickname, the "Beehive State." It represents the pioneer spirit of hard work, thrift, and self-reliance that were important qualities to the early settlers of Utah. The beehive is a powerful symbol of community and cooperation, as bees work together to create something greater than themselves. It also represents the idea of unity and working towards a common goal.
